1. Classic Cinnamon Sugar Donuts

These donuts are simple yet full of holiday warmth with a sweet cinnamon-sugar coating.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/4 cup melted butter
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/4 cup sugar + 1 tsp cinnamon for coating

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a donut pan.
  2. In a bowl, whisk fl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and cinnamon.
  3. In another bowl, mix buttermilk, eggs, melted butter, and vanilla.
  4. Combine wet and dry ingredients until smooth.
  5. Fill donut pan 3/4 full and bake for 12–14 minutes.
  6. Let cool slightly, then toss in cinnamon-sugar mixture.

How to Serve It
Serve warm with a cup of hot cocoa. Sprinkle extra cinnamon sugar for a festive touch.


2. Gingerbread Donuts

These donuts are packed with molasses and holiday spices for a cozy, festive flavor.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 2 tsp ground ginger
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p nutmeg
  • 1/4 tsp cloves
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up molasses
  • 1/2 cup milk

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Whisk fl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and spices.
  3. Beat butter and sugar until fluffy, then add eggs and molasses.
  4. Gradually mix in flour and milk until smooth.
  5. Fill donut pan 3/4 full, bake 12–15 minutes.
  6. Cool slightly before glazing or dusting with powdered sugar.

How to Serve It
Top with a simple glaze or crushed gingerbread cookies for a festive look.


3. Peppermint Glazed Donuts

A refreshing peppermint glaze makes these donuts perfect for the holiday season.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p milk (for glaze)
  • 1/2 tsp peppermint extract
  • Crushed candy canes for topping

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ix flour, baking powder, salt, and sugar.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la; fold into d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ix powdered sugar, milk, and peppermint extract for glaze.
  6. Dip cooled donuts in glaze and sprinkle crushed candy canes on top.

How to Serve It
Serve chilled or at room temperature with a peppermint hot chocolate.


4. Eggnog Donuts

Soft donuts infused with eggnog flavors bring holiday nostalgia to your kitchen.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p nutmeg
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, softened
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up eggnog
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p eggnog for gl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and nutmeg.
  3. Beat butter and sugar, add eggs, then eggnog and vanilla.
  4. Combine wet and dry ingredients, f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ix powdered sugar and eggnog for glaze, drizzle over cooled donuts.

How to Serve It
Sprinkle with a little extra nutmeg for a festive finish.


5. Cranberry Orange Donuts

The bright citrus notes and tart cranberries make these donuts cheerful for the holidays.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• Zest of 1 orange
  • 1/2 cup dried cranberries
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p orange juice for gl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sugar.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, vanilla, and orange zest; fold into dry ingredients.
  4. Fold in dried cranberries.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ix powdered sugar and orange juice for glaze; drizzle over donuts.

How to Serve It
Garnish with extra cranberries or orange zest.


6. Chocolate Hazelnut Donuts

Decadent chocolate meets crunchy hazelnuts for a holiday treat that feels indulgent yet cozy.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up chocolate-hazelnut spread
  • 1/4 cup crushed toasted hazelnuts

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a donut pan.
  2. Mix flour, cocoa,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sugar.
  3. Whisk but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la, then combine with d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full and b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Warm chocolate-hazelnut spread and drizzle over cooled donuts; top with crushed hazelnuts.

How to Serve It
Serve slightly warm with coffee or hot cocoa.


7. Maple Pecan Donuts

Sweet maple flavor paired with crunchy pecans brings autumn and winter vibes to the holidays.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up chopped toasted pecans
  • 1/2 cup maple syrup
  • 1 cup powdered sugar (for glaze)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sugar.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la, then mix with d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Make glaze by mixing maple syrup and powdered sugar, then drizzle over cooled donuts; sprinkle pecans on top.

How to Serve It
Pair with a warm cup of spiced tea or cider.


8. Pumpkin Spice Donuts

A classic holiday favorite featuring pumpkin puree and warm spices like cinnamon and nutmeg.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p nutmeg
  • 1/4 tsp cloves
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up pumpkin puree
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Whisk dry ingredients with spices.
  3. Beat butter, sugar, eggs, pumpkin, milk, and vanilla.
  4. Combine wet and dry ingredients; fill donut pan 3/4 full.
  5. Bake 12–14 minutes; cool slightly before glazing or dusting with cinnamon sugar.

How to Serve It
Serve with a drizzle of cream cheese glaze for extra festive flavor.


9. Caramel Apple Donuts

Sweet apple flavor and sticky caramel make these donuts a perfect holiday indulgence.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up finely chopped apples
  • 1/2 cup caramel sauce
  • 1/4 cup chopped walnuts (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sugar.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la; fold in dry ingredients.
  4. Stir in chopped apples.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Drizzle with caramel and sprinkle walnuts if desired.

How to Serve It
Serve warm with extra caramel sauce on the side.


10. Chai Spice Donuts

Warm chai spices like cardamom and cinnamon make these donuts aromatic and festive.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p cardamom
  • 1/4 tsp nutmeg
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ients with spices.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la; mix with d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full and b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Optionally, drizzle with a simple sugar glaze and sprinkle cinnamon.

How to Serve It
Pair with a cup of spiced chai tea for a cozy holiday morning.


11. White Chocolate Raspberry Donuts


Sweet white chocolate and tart raspberry combine for a pretty, holiday-ready treat.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up white chocolate chips
  • 1/4 cup freeze-dried raspberries

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ine wet ingredients; fold into dry mixture.
  4. Stir in white chocolate chips and raspberries. B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Optional: drizzle melted white chocolate over cooled donuts.

How to Serve It
Top with a few extra freeze-dried raspberries for a festive touch.


12. Mocha Donuts

Coffee and chocolate flavors make these donuts a sophisticated holiday treat.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tbsp instant coffee dissolved in 1 tbsp hot water
  • 1/2 cup chocolate gl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Whisk butter, eggs, milk, vanilla, and coffee; combine with d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Glaze cooled donuts with chocolate glaze.

How to Serve It
Sprinkle lightly with cocoa powder or coffee granules for a finishing touch.


13. Toasted Coconut Donuts

Sweet coconut adds a tropical twist to the holiday season.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up shredded coconut, toasted

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ine wet ingredients, then fold into dry mixture.
  4. Bake 12–14 minutes; cool slightly.
  5. Sprinkle toasted coconut on top or dip in glaze first.

How to Serve It
Pair with a coconut glaze or sprinkle extra toasted coconut.


14. Spiced Almond Donuts

Warm almond flavor with a touch of spice makes these donuts perfect for the season.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p nutmeg
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p almond extract
  • 1/2 cup slivered almonds
  • 1 cup powdered sugar (for glaze)
  • 2–3 tbsp milk for gl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ients with spices.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, and almond extract; fold into d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ix glaze ingredients, drizzle over cooled donuts, sprinkle almonds on top.

How to Serve It
Garnish with extra almond slivers and serve with holiday tea.


15. Lemon Cranberry Donuts

Bright lemon flavor paired with tart cranberries brings a cheerful note to holiday mornings.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• Zest of 1 lemon
  • 1/2 cup fresh or dried cranberries
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p lemon juice for gl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ients, add lemon zest.
  3. Combine but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la; fold into dry mixture.
  4. Fold in cranberries, f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Drizzle with lemon glaze after cooling.

How to Serve It
Garnish with extra cranberries and a light dusting of powdered sugar.


16. Sugar Cookie Donuts

Fun and colorful, these donuts taste just like classic holiday sugar cookies.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up powdered sugar (for glaze)
  • 2–3 tbsp milk
  • Holiday sprinkles

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ine wet ingredients and fold into dry mixture.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ix powdered sugar and milk for glaze, dip cooled donuts, add sprinkles.

How to Serve It
Perfect for holiday parties or gifting in decorative boxes.


17. Brown Butter Donuts

Nutty brown butter flavor makes these donuts rich and comforting for winter mornings.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up brown butter (cooled)
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p milk for gl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ine brown but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la; fold into dry mixture.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Make glaze by mixing powdered sugar and milk, drizzle over cooled donuts.

How to Serve It
Optional: sprinkle with cinnamon or crushed nuts for added texture.


18. Candy Cane Twist Donuts

Peppermint-striped donuts make a cheerful addition to holiday desserts.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• Red food coloring (optional)
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p milk
  • Crushed candy canes

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ine wet ingredients, optionally add red food coloring to a portion of batter.
  4. Layer or twist batters in pan,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Glaze with powdered sugar mixture and sprinkle crushed candy canes.

How to Serve It
Great for a festive breakfast or as a holiday gift treat.


19. Nutmeg Glaze Donuts

A simple glaze with a hint of nutmeg gives classic donuts a warm holiday aroma.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p milk
  • 1/4 tsp ground nutmeg

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ine wet ingredients, fold into dry mixture.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ix glaze with powdered sugar, milk, and nutmeg; drizzle over cooled donuts.

How to Serve It
Serve with coffee or tea for a simple yet festive treat.


20. Hot Cocoa Donuts

Chocolate lovers will enjoy these donuts topped with mini marshmallows like a cup of hot cocoa.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up chocolate glaze
  • Mini marshmallows for topping

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ients.
  3. Combine wet ingredients, fold into dry mixture.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Glaze with chocolate, top with mini marshmallows while warm.

How to Serve It
Perfect alongside a steaming cup of hot cocoa.


21. Ginger Molasses Donuts

Ginger and molasses give these donuts a deep, warm flavor perfect for holiday mornings.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 2 tsp ground ginger
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p cloves
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up molasses
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2–3 tbsp milk for glaze

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ease donut pan.
  2. Mix dry ingredients with spices.
  3. Beat butter, eggs, molasses, milk, and vanilla; combine with dry ingredients.
  4. Fill pan 3/4 full, bake 12–14 minutes.
  5. Mix powdered sugar and milk for glaze; drizzle over cooled donuts.

How to Serve It
Optional: dust lightly with powdered sugar for a snow-kissed holiday look.
